Process control and optimization pco is the discipline of adjusting a process to maintain or optimize a specified set of parameters without violating process constraints. Advanced process control and realtime optimization are techniques that can improve a plants profitability and efficiency by maintaining a process at desired operating conditions while taking process constraints into account.
